Actually, there's no such problem. Google Play accepts GPL apps. Android
itself is licensed under the Apache software license. Not only that but you
can also legally distribute apps without going through the app store - the
users have to change some default settings, but there's no need to jailbreak
the device.

That still leaves the problem of diverting valuable developer time into a
complex side project, so it's probably best not to even consider it, but
livensing and distribution are not the problem.
